After this week, Christian Thompson's 4 game suspension will be up and the Ravens will be forced to make a decision on him.

 

If no one was paying attention to him during the preseason, you're lucky.  He was dreadful in all aspects of the game.  He had one big hit, but otherwise looked completely lost out there.  So, what do we do with him?

 

Obviously, Elam, Ihedigbo, and Huff will all remain on the roster.  The new guy, Miles, has drawn praise from coaches.  They love him already.  Levine has been a steady contributor on ST as well.  Even our PS guys, Trawick and Omar Brown, seem likely to get playing time before Thompson.

 

Do we cut him this soon?  He was a 4th round pick just last year, which wouldn't be something that the Ravens would ordinarily do.  Do we bring him back on the 53 man?  Or do we come up with some fake injury and hope he can turn things around next year?
